Hockenheim (DE), 3rd May 2015. Martin Tomczyk (DE) came home fourth in the second race of the 2015 DTM season in Hockenheim (DE), making him the best-placed BMW driver. The 2011 DTM champion produced a flawless display in the BMW M Performance Parts M4 DTM, first in dry conditions and then in the rain, and narrowly missed out on the podium.

The rain started to fall a third of the way into the 60-minute race and resulted in plenty of action on the wet track. Reigning DTM champion Marco Wittmann (DE) finished fifth in the Ice-Watch BMW M4 DTM. BMW Team MTEK team-mates Bruno Spengler (CA) and Timo Glock (DE) also picked up valuable points in ninth and tenth. Victory in Sunday’s race went to Audi’s Mattias Ekström (SE).

Reactions to the second race of the 2015 DTM season.

Jens Marquardt (BMW Motorsport Director): “That was an exciting race today, in really difficult conditions. The fans were treated to spectacular manoeuvres every minute throughout the entire race. We made good use of our options today. Martin Tomczyk, in particular, drove a flawless race and fully deserved to be the top BMW driver in fourth place.”

Martin Tomczyk (BMW Team Schnitzer, 4th): “That was one of my most exhausting races. I had a few problems with the tyre pressure in the rain. That is why I was unable to hang on to a podium position and had to let Gary Paffett through. We had a good, fair fight. Congratulations to him and the winner Mattias Ekström. They were simply faster than me today. Despite that, I am very happy with fourth place.”

Facts and figures.

Circuit/length/duration:

Hockenheimring, 4.574 kilometres, 60 minutes plus one lap

Conditions:

Rain, 20 degrees Celsius

BMW Motorsport results:

#77 Martin Tomczyk (DE), BMW Team Schnitzer, BMW M Performance Parts M4 DTM – 4th

#1 Marco Wittmann (DE), BMW Team RMG, Ice-Watch BMW M4 DTM – 5th

#7 Bruno Spengler (CA), BMW Team MTEK, BMW Bank M4 DTM – 9th

#16 Timo Glock (DE), BMW Team MTEK, DEUTSCHE POST BMW M4 DTM – 10th

#36 Maxime Martin (BE), BMW Team RMG, SAMSUNG BMW M4 DTM – 14th

#31 Tom Blomqvist (GB), BMW Team RBM, BMW M4 DTM – 17th

#13 António Félix da Costa (PT), BMW Team Schnitzer, Red Bull BMW M4 DTM – 20th

#18 Augusto Farfus (BR), BMW Team RBM, Shell BMW M4 DTM – 21st

Information:

Martin Tomczyk was the best-placed BMW driver in the field for the first time since the 2012 race at the Norisring.

Bruno Spengler scored his first points for BMW Team MTEK.

Maxime Martin was given a drive-through penalty for “unsafe release” during the pit stop.

Four BMW M4 DTMs finished in the points in both races in Hockenheim.
